Summary
Gramophone record with blue paper central label with gold lettering; MAGIC NOTES / COLUMBIA / SPEED 78 / LX8553 / CONCERTO IN D MAJOR / FOR VIOLIN AND ORCHESTRA / FIRST MOVEMENT / JOSEPH SZIGET (Violin) / with the PHILADELPHIA ORCHESTRA. Stamped into shellac is; XCO 34297. The reverse side is similar and reads; MAGIC NOTES / COLUMBIA / SPEED 78 / LX8553 / CONCERTO IN D MAJOR / FOR VIOLIN AND ORCHESTRA / THIRD MOVEMENT / JOSEPH SZIGET (Violin) / with the PHILADELPHIA ORCHESTRA. Stamped into shellac is; XCO 34303.
Provenance
Purchased from the estate of the late Lord Wraxall with the assistance of the NHMF and donations from members and supporters.
